Chief Operating Officer

The Boys & Girls Club of Greenwich (BGCG) is seeking an experienced Chief Operating Officer to lead the day-to-day operations that support high-quality programs and services for thousands of young people each year. Reporting to the CEO, the COO will oversee program delivery, staffing, and organizational systems while translating strategy into action. The ideal candidate is a hands-on leader with a passion for youth development and strong operational expertise who can build effective teams, strengthen systems, use data to drive improvement, and foster strong partnerships with families, schools, and the community.

Organizational

Leadership & Strategy
  • Provide strategic leadership for all programmatic and operational functions, ensuring safe, high-quality, mission-driven services.
  • Partner with the CEO and leadership team to develop, implement, and monitor BGCG's strategic plan.
  • Lead, coach, and develop senior staff, fostering a culture of collaboration, innovation, and continuous improvement.
  • Establish organizational goals, key performance indicators (KPIs), and dashboards to measure program quality, operational effectiveness, member outcomes, and strategic progress.
Program & Operational Excellence
  • Direct the design and delivery of all youth development programs — after-school, teen, workforce development, and family engagement.
  • Ensure programs meet Boys & Girls Club of America (BGCA) standards and best practices in youth development, academic success, and social-emotional learning, with safety embedded in every program area.
  • Lead membership outreach efforts to grow enrollment and expand BGCG's reach into underserved parts of the community.
  • Strengthen teen-focused programming to boost engagement, belonging, and retention.
  • Use data, member feedback, and evaluation to track program efficacy, identify opportunities for innovation, and set measurable outcomes that drive continuous improvement plans for staff.
  • Oversee facility operations to ensure safe, welcoming, and efficient environments for members and staff.
Talent & Culture
  • Lead recruitment, onboarding, supervision, professional development, and retention of program and operations staff.
  • Implement performance management systems that promote accountability, leadership development, and continuous learning.
  • Foster an inclusive, collaborative, and youth-centered culture aligned with BGCG's mission and values.
Financial & Resource Management
  • Develop and manage program and operational budgets in partnership with the finance team.
  • Monitor financial performance, staffing, and resource allocation to maximize efficiency while maintaining high-quality services.
  • Support organizational sustainability through thoughtful planning and operational stewardship.
Boys & Girls Clubs of America (BGCA)
  • Ensure compliance with BGCA standards, reporting requirements, and the Nationally Designated Youth Serving Organization (NDYSO) model.
  • Leverage BGCA resources, training, and best practices to strengthen organizational performance and program quality.
  • Represent BGCG within the BGCA network and participate in national and regional learning opportunities.
Qualifications
  • 7-10 years of progressive senior management experience in youth development, education, or human services organization (Boys & Girls Club experience strongly preferred)
  • Bachelor's degree required; advance degree in education social services, nonprofit management, or related field preferred
  • Demonstrated success leading programs and teams in complex, mission-driven environments
  • Demonstrated team leadership, coaching, and staff development experience
  • Experience using data and evaluation to improve programs and outcomes
  • Knowledge of youth development best practices, facilities management, and safety standards for youth-serving organizations
  • Familiarity with BCGA standards, resources, and reporting requirements preferred
  • Excellent communication, relationship-building, and collaboration skills
  • Ability to balance strategic thinking with hands-on operational leadership services
  • Background in trauma-informed care preferred
